Model: Deco M4  
Hardware Version: V1
Firmware Version: 1.1.0

Hello!

 

I have a problem with access through a local network to one of my devices, Sonos Move smart speaker. The speaker works and gets Internet connection, because it plays music from Spotify, so there is no problem with Internet access from the speaker itself. 

 

The problem is to access the speaker from my phone (Samsung Galaxy S10) when my phone is connected to another Deco node than the speaker. 

I have a 4G modem which acts as a router and Deco M4 set up in the access point mode. I also have one additional extender device M3W, the Move is connected to that M3W extender. 

 

When my phone is connected to the same M3W extender, everything works perfectly, but when I move to the place with the main M4 access point, the link to the Move speaker drops, I'm unable to control it from the phone. I'm also unable to open the tech support page of the speaker located at http://192.168.8.178:1400/support/review

However when I move to the M3W access point, then connection to the Move speaker restores and above mentioned URL is also working correctly. 

 

It is a bit annoying, please advice on what could be done?

 

Just checked from another phone - Samsung Galaxy S20 and it works, so the problem seems to be related to my S10 phone only. Very strange.

Have you tried statically assigning a static IP on the problem phone?

 

Another thing I remember is that on Android 10 it introduces a feature where it randomizes the MAC address. Try and disable that to see if that may be causing issues.

 

I think this may be the procedure how:

 

  1. Open the Settings app.
  2. Select Network and Internet.
  3. Select WiFi.
  4. Connect to the UT wireless network (UT Open or EDUROAM)
  5. Tap the gear icon next to the current wifi connection.
  6. Select Advanced.
  7. Select Privacy.
  8. Select "Use device MAC"

@Tony Thank you for your reply! 

 

I've turned off random MAC in my WiFi settings on the phone and I've also added my device MAC to static DHCP clients table in my router. 

 

Directly after reconnect to the Deco mesh WiFi network the problem has disappeared. 

I will continue monitoring how it works further.

So after some days of testing, unfortunately, the problem persists and I'm unable to contact to those devices being connected to another mesh AP. It is a strange problem, because it is isolated currently specifically to my phone. 

A PC, other phone,  work fine. However I don't test them as much time, as my phone. 

 

The only workaround is to reboot an AP connected to those devices, then for some time my phone can connect, but later the problem appears again. 

 

My phone currently has static IP configuration in the WiFi network settings.
